New Procedure for Chemical Fertilizer Distribution Implemented
Summary
The Ministry of Agriculture and Livestock Development has implemented a new procedure for chemical fertilizer distribution to ensure effective, subsidized supply to farmers, emphasizing equitable quota allocation, digital monitoring, and stringent vendor regulations.
Key Points
- The Ministry of Agriculture has implemented the 'Subsidized Fertilizer Distribution Management Procedure, 2082' to distribute chemical fertilizers at subsidized rates.
- Fertilizer quota allocation will use scientific criteria including arable land, cropping intensity, irrigated area, past fertilizer usage, and special crop areas.
- A mandatory 10 percent buffer stock will be maintained to prevent shortages during the main crop season.
- Digital monitoring software is mandatory for transparency and prevention of black marketing in fertilizer distribution.
